Legal Administration


Overview of the Department

The Legal Administration Department at the Technical Institute of Administration – Duhok, part of Duhok Polytechnic University, was originally established in the academic year 2009–2010. After several years of operation, the department temporarily suspended its activities between 2014–2015 and 2022–2023, but it resumed operations in the 2023–2024 academic year. Since then, the department has actively provided education and training in the field of legal administration.

The program follows the Bologna Process and spans two academic years, consisting of four semesters and a summer training period in both public and private sector institutions. Graduates of the Legal Administration Department are well-prepared to work in various legal and administrative roles across both sectors. High-achieving students have the opportunity to pursue a bachelor’s degree in Law at public or private colleges.
